Hey uk1 and other Zojirushi owners - do you find that brown rice sticks to the cooking pot? Do you have to pre-soak brown rice?
Basically, I want to be able to throw rice, veggies, and maybe chicken or fish in the rice cooker and have dinner ready. I would also like to be able to make oatmeal. Do I even need a fancy rice cooker, or will a simple one suffice for this? If so, which simple one do people recommend? I want the fancy Zoji because I want a new toy...but I can't quite justify the expense.
I've had absolutely no sticking to the pot of my Zojirushi. This includes unrinsed brown rice and steel-cut oats with chopped dates. The timer function on my Zo is great, esp. for having the oatmeal ready when I wake up in the morning. I read on Chowhound that the Zoji 'neuro-fuzzy' cookers are the ones to get if you'll be doing much with grains other than rice (e.g., oats, quinoa, etc.). Apparently the 'micom' is not the same as the 'neuro-fuzzy'.
